Dr. Sang Seung Kang is a leading figure in industrial robotics and intelligent automation, with a focused expertise in vision-based object recognition and pose estimation for smart manufacturing. His seminal 2013 work, "Object Recognition Method for Industrial Intelligent Robot," has garnered 7 citations and laid critical groundwork for integrating 2D and 3D vision sensors into automated factory systems. Kang’s primary contribution addresses the formidable challenge of enabling robots to accurately identify and locate parts under variable illumination and complex conditions—a key bottleneck in packaging and assembly lines. By advancing robust algorithms for object recognition and pose estimation, his research has directly enhanced the reliability and efficiency of industrial intelligent robots.
